Mansfield, Louisiana

Introduction to Mansfield, Louisiana

Mansfield, Louisiana, in De Soto county, is 33 miles S of Bossier City, Louisiana (center to center) and 185 miles NE of Houston, Texas. As of the year 2000 census, 5,582 people lived in Mansfield.

Mansfield History

The city of Mansfield is the parish seat in De Soto Parish. It is located in the Shreveport - Bossier City metro area. The city has been witness to the Battle of Mansfield that took place in the year 1864. Even though the city faced difficulties in development, it recovered from its past injuries in the middle of the 19th century. Higher Education became prominent henceforth as several women’s colleges were built in the area.

Things To Do In Mansfield

The Scarlett O'Hardy's Gone With the Wind Museum displays memorabilia of the movie. Tourists can also take a look at the Mansfield State Historic Site that is spread across a large area displaying the Civil War exhibits. The Sci - Port Discovery Center is another place where tourists can spend their free hours. One can also plan a trip to the Lake Bistineau State Park and Martin Creek Lake State Park.
